Transaction 982f0828dbbf5696ab7915ee108c63cea7b5d707e37961021e710bf43fc95667
1 Input
2 Outputs
- 982f0828dbbf5696ab7915ee108c63cea7b5d707e37961021e710bf43fc95667:0
- 982f0828dbbf5696ab7915ee108c63cea7b5d707e37961021e710bf43fc95667:1
value 3599325
address 1FFAejMidkEiQR3hBNvfgsXBAK7z1Ezw7x
value 7866898
address 3DdvopLodjZ2nbcYgM8fjjBeBJKKUkGQ1F